This desktop fiber laser marking machine is specifically designed to meet the marking needs of various industries and is suitable for permanent marking on a wide range of materials, including metal, plastic, wood, and cardboard. Equipped with a 10-inch high-definition touchscreen, the device allows for independent editing of text, barcodes, QR codes, and graphics without the need for a computer connection. It supports marking areas of 80×80 mm or 110×110 mm, offering both ease of operation and high precision. Its proprietary intelligent control system enables a quick startup in 3–5 seconds, and the 20W laser power is capable of marking most hard materials. Widely used in the food, electronics, pharmaceutical, and custom gift industries, it is an efficient tool for enhancing product traceability and brand recognition.
The QDFJ-125 Fully Automatic Ultrasonic Tube Filling and Sealing Machine is specifically designed for packaging soft tubes used in cosmetics, toothpaste, ointments, and similar products. It integrates precise filling, ultrasonic sealing, and automatic trimming into a single unit, capable of processing approximately 900 tubes per hour. It accommodates tubes with diameters ranging from 15 to 30 mm and heights from 60 to 200 mm. The machine utilizes servo control and a PLC system to ensure filling accuracy within ±1%, with no dripping or leakage, and produces secure, aesthetically pleasing seals. Widely used in the personal care, pharmaceutical, and food industries, it is a core piece of equipment for enhancing packaging consistency and production efficiency.

ribbon coding machine is a marking device that utilizes thermal printing ribbon instead of traditional ink. It belongs to the category of coding machines and is primarily used for marking surface information on packaging materials. It achieves flexible character change through a movable type loading and unloading structure, and is suitable for various materials such as plastic film, aluminum foil, paper products, and electronic component casings. It features no ink pollution, economy, and hygiene. This equipment utilizes thermal printing technology to form clear and indelible marks, supports printing in two or three columns of different sizes, and is compatible with common plastics and composite materials such as PT, PE, and PVC. Typical models include the HP-241 and HP-30, which offer different power and size specifications to meet the needs of food packaging, industrial product labeling, and other scenarios. The dual-head printing function can simultaneously print production dates, batch numbers, and traceability codes, effectively improving efficiency and supporting anti-counterfeiting and traceability. Its core advantages include convenient operation, strong material adaptability, and high practicality in the field of flexible packaging production.
